1. At the top of the page are a number of options. Go to "User CP" (first on the list).Quote:
Originally Posted by Omanes Alexandrapolites
2. On the User CP page there is a sidebar with a number of options. Under the main heading of "Private Messages" there are a number of sub-options. Choose "List Messages".
3. You'll want to save your PMs to your hard drive before you do any deleting, so under the list of PMs you'll find an option to "Download all Private Messages" as. I personally prefer text, but you can choose xml, csv or whatever else is to your liking. When saving the PMs to your hard drive, take care to note where you're saving it to.
4. Once you've safely archived your PMs, it's time to start deleting. At the top of your list of messages is a tick box. Tick the topmost tick box, which will automatically tick everything else. Under your list of messages is an option "Selected Messages" to do something with your ticked messages. In that combo box, choose Delete, then click on the Go button beside the combo box. Voila, you've deleted all the PMs in your inbox.
5. To do the same with your sentbox, you'll first need to go to your sentbox. Above your list of messages is a combo box, titled "Jump to Folder". Choose "Sent Items", then click on Go beside the combo box. Once you've listed your sent box, repeat step 4. Congrats, you've cleared your PM box.
